Valle di Rose, Parco d'Abruzzo
Abruzzo
The Valle di Rose above Opi in the Parco Nazionale d'Abruzzo, Lazio e Molise is the single best place in Italy for Marsican brown bear — the population is ~50 individuals and dawn visits to the valley give very high sighting probability. Apennine chamois are numerous. Golden eagle overhead. The valley is enclosed by karst ridges. Dogs on leash (park rules).
